当前位置: 主页 > PLC控制

TIA博途软件PID做温度控制

一、我们用电动调节阀调节温度,在博途软件中应用个PID目录下哪个函数块最好?PID_compact(集成了调节功能通用PID控制器),PID_3STp(集成了阀门调节功能的PID控制器),PID_Temp(温度PID控制器)。为什么?
二、假如用S7-1500P做温度控制,温度测量元件为热电阻(直接接在PLC模块下),控制执行机构为电动调节阀,调用PID_compact函数,请问:1、参数SeTPoint(设定值)是用常数直接输入还是百分比输入,如是百分比应如何转换。2、过程值Input-PER可直接指向模块地址热电阻的值,要转换吗?输出值Outpuf_PER可直接连到PLC模拟量输出端吗?要转换吗?3、如果过程值采=采用Input,输出采用Out_put又如何处理
.

问题补充:
最好有实例讲解

最佳答案

PID_Temp工艺对象提供具有集成调节功能的连续PID控制器。PID_Temp专为温度控制而设计,适用于加热或加热/制冷应用。为此提供了两路输出,分别用于加热和制冷。PID_Temp还可以用于其它控制任务。PID_Temp可以级联,可以在手动或自动模式下使用。
1、参数Setpoint(设定值)是用常数直接输入还是百分比输入要和PV输入对应,即要求为相同量纲。
2、使用Input-PER要设定转换系数,对于普通热电阻乘以0.1就是温度值,气候型热电阻乘以0.01,Outpuf_PER可直接连到模拟量输出端,不用转换。
3、过程值采用Input则需要用scale指令对输入值做转换,可以转换为过程值,也可是百分比值,要和设定值对应,输出采用Out_put的话要转换成0-27648的整数类型再连到模拟量输出。

PID控制相对有些复杂,建议多参考编程系统手册。

提问者对于答案的评价:

专家置评

已阅,最佳答案正确。

  • 关注微信

猜你喜欢

微信公众号